THE BULGARIAN CRISIS.

KAULBAR’S TACTICS APPROVED. RUSSIAN SAH/HtS LAND AT VARNA. London, Nov. 2. Official messages have been received, hinting that the rc L s of General Kaulbars in Bulgaria have met with tue highest approval of the Czar. Sofia, Nov. 2. One hundred sailors have been landed at Varna from Russian vessels now in harbor. Received Nov. 5, 10.30 p.m. Sofia, Nov. 3. It is now stated that the sailors who were landed from the Russian war vesseli at Varni were only proceeding home on furlough.
